Unfortunately, last I checked, the apps are not very accessible at all, the new 
version 4 also does not work in windows. Fortunately there is a work around, 
you can read purchased books on their web site, biblia.com. You can sign in to 
your logos account on this site and read your purchased books, not that this 
excuses logos lack of accessibility in their applications, but at least there 
is an alternative.
